About This Item

New York: The Review of all Reviews Co, 1909. Hardcover. Very Good with no dust jacket. Red boards, sharp corners, gilt lettering on spine, binding very good, pages clean; THE LOCK AND KEY LIBRARY; Vol. 10; 7.70 X 5.10 X 1.30 inches; 162 pages.
